About Livspace
Established in 2014, Livspace has emerged as Asia's largest and fastest-growing platform for home interiors and renovation, streamlining the often fragmented home interior process for homeowners. Starting as a solution to challenges like identifying reliable designers, vendor coordination, and maintaining quality along with fair pricing, Livspace today is a trusted platform that has completed over 120,000 homes with the support of more than 2,000 designers. The company merges design, technology, and implementation expertise to create innovative consumer experiences in India and Singapore.
Role Overview
The Design Associate is responsible for the complete execution of Kitchen, Wardrobe, and Storage (KWS) design details, ensuring precision, superior quality, and timely delivery of design materials. Collaboration with designers to grasp client requirements and translate them into detailed AutoCAD designs, bills of quantities (BOQs), and consolidated design documents is integral to this role. The associate must adhere strictly to Livspace design guidelines, service level agreements (SLAs), and quality expectations, incorporating feedback from validation processes accurately.
Key Responsibilities
- Engage with designers via calls or face-to-face meetings to comprehend client specifications for KWS requirements.
- Develop a thorough understanding of all KWS modules and technical specifications within Livspace’s KWS category.
- Create detailed AutoCAD plans and wall-to-wall elevations for kitchen, wardrobe, and storage spaces.
- Detail electrical points (EPT) and granite specifications relevant to kitchen, wardrobe, and storage designs.
- Prepare KWS bills of quantities using Livspace's design tool, CANVAS.
- Compile coordinated design dockets aligned with BOQ, including accurate annotations and details, following standardized templates specified by Livspace's Central Team.
- Incorporate corrective measures and modifications based on feedback from the Validation Team into design dockets.
- Maintain adherence to stipulated SLAs and consistently meet quality standards in deliverables.
- Participate in training sessions provided by the Category Team to remain current with new module introductions and updates.
